Hey guys can anyone help. When I recording on say 10 tracks and I want to record a 2nd take on all. How do I choose take 2 for all? I grouped all the tracks but I had to go thru each one and choose take 2. Thanks

By default, the keyboard shortcut ctrl-opt-n creates a new take in all record-enabled tracks.

Select your tracks. Press "t" and keep it down while you select New Take from any selected track. Bam!

Or, you can group your tracks normally, but you need to make sure you have set the things that you want your group to respond to (takes, in this case).
Remember you can have lots of groups with lots of different properties (things they will do as a group). Maybe you just want a group of tracks for selection, or only for showing, or maybe you want it to respond to everything.

Yeah... hold 'T'... and make sure that the Take stuff is enabled in Temporary Group Type (Group window/mini menu).
